Re: RCBS primer pocket swager
I've used both and I can honestly say i'd use the bench one every time. I borrowed the press one and by the time I'd gone through a few hundred cases the rod looked like a pigs knob! RCBS send you a free replacement if you ask for one (well actually they sent two ) but the bench one is way more sturdy if you've got a lot of cases to do.

Re: RCBS primer pocket swager
With the press/die version it's critical that the rod is screwed tightly into the top of the die and tightened with the locking nut. Otherwise, you'll damage tho rod. The one downside to the press/die version is that removing the cases is a bit violent. It's not a simple push to pop the case off, you really have to hit the handle hard to knock the case off the stud. Doing this for any length of time is a bit painful on the palm of your hand. Not sure if the bench mounted one has the same problem.
